…Medieval tunics, such as the cotto and dalmatica, had sleeves that were continuous with the body, and sleeves that either fitted or flared to the wrist appeared. The surco, an outer garment worn over the cotto, and a variation of the cotto called the cotardie, were decorative in contrast to the tight sleeves of the undergarment, with long, thin cuffs that hung down or had string-like sleeve decorations called tippets. In general, the sleeves of the outer garment were wide, and the sleeves of the undergarment were visible from the cuffs. … *Some of the terminology that mentions "cotardie" is listed below.
